How do online real estate calculators work?

Online property valuation tools operate by analyzing vast databases of real estate information to generate automated estimates. These systems collect data from multiple sources including recent property transactions, government records, and market analytics. The algorithms consider factors such as property size, location, age, recent renovations, and comparable sales in the neighborhood.

Most calculators use automated valuation models (AVMs) that process this information through statistical algorithms. They compare your property against similar homes that have recently sold, adjusting for differences in size, condition, and features. The system then generates an estimated value range based on these comparisons and current market conditions.

How accurate are online review results?

The accuracy of online property valuations varies significantly depending on the platform and available data. Most reputable calculators achieve accuracy rates between 70-90% for initial estimates, though this can vary based on property type and location uniqueness. Standard residential properties in well-established neighborhoods typically receive more accurate estimates than unique or recently renovated properties.

Factors that can affect accuracy include limited recent sales data, unique property features, recent market changes, and incomplete property information. Online estimates work best as starting points rather than definitive valuations, particularly for properties with distinctive characteristics or in rapidly changing markets.

While online calculators provide valuable preliminary insights, they should complement rather than replace professional appraisals for significant financial decisions. Licensed valuers consider factors that automated systems might miss, such as property condition, unique features, and localized market nuances that can significantly impact actual market value.
